filename: Specifies the name of the file for saving the local host public key. The file name is a string of
case-insensitive characters excluding ./ and ../. The name cannot be dots (.), hostkey, serverkey, dsakey,
or ecdsakey, and cannot start with a slash (/).For more information about file name, see Fundamentals
Configuration Guide.
Usage guidelines
Whether the command exports or displays the host public key depends on the presence of the filename
argument.
You can use the command to display or export the local RSA host public keys before distributing it to a
peer device.
1. Save the local host public key to a file with one of the following methods:
{ Use the public-key local export rsa [ name key-name ] { openssh | ssh2 } command to display
the host public key in the specified format, copy and paste it to a file.
{ Use the public-key local export rsa [ name key-name ] { openssh | ssh2 } filename command to
export the host public key to the file. You cannot export the host public key to the folder pkey
and its subfolders.
2. Transfer a copy of the file to the peer device, for example, by using FTP or TFTP in binary mode.
3. On the peer device, use the public-key peer import sshkey command to import the host public key
from the file.
SSH1.5, SSH2.0 and OpenSSH are different public key formats. Choose the proper format that is
supported on the device where you import the host public key. In FIPS mode, the device only supports
SSH2.0 and OpenSSH.
Examples
# Export the host public key of the local RSA key pair with the default name in OpenSSH format to the
file key.pub.
<Sysname> system-view
[Sysname] public-key local export rsa openssh key.pub
# Display the host public key of the local RSA key pair with the default name in SSH2.0 format.
<Sysname> system-view
[Sysname] public-key local export rsa ssh2
